The Cursed Child will not reopen with other Broadway shows this Fall as it rethinks its length and structure, targeting a 2022 return\n\nWhat's at the heart of this decision? We discuss a few ways The Cursed Child could accomplish a cutdown version of the show.\n\nMain Discussion: Revisiting The Best of MuggleNet and other Potter Fan Sites, particularly during the biggest year for Harry Potter\n\nThe hosts revisit their roles and how they got their start in the Potter fandom\n\nThe layouts, the countdowns, the breaking news: what were some of our favorite parts of\xa0 MuggleNet?\n\nThe Wall of Shame, Editorials, MuggleSpace and more!\n\nBe sure to check out older versions of MuggleNet using The Wayback Machine!\n\nWhat was the rivalry like with other Harry Potter fansites?\n\nThe hosts read their old staff profiles from 2007 - laughter... and cringing ensue!\n\nOur patrons share their favorite parts and memories of MuggleNet\n\nQuizzitch: Some of the earliest Harry Potter fan conventions were run by a group called HPEF.
